[发明专利]移动通信系统中大量数据上报时的数据处理方法有效
申请号: | 200710138755.8 | 申请日: | 2007-08-16 |
公开(公告)号: | CN101102281A | 公开(公告)日: | 2008-01-09 |
发明(设计)人: | 陈世雄 | 申请(专利权)人: | 中兴通讯股份有限公司 |
主分类号: | H04L12/56 | 分类号: | H04L12/56;H04Q7/22 |
代理公司: | 北京安信方达知识产权代理有限公司 | 代理人: | 龙洪;霍育栋 |
地址: | 518057广东省深圳市南山*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 移动 通信 系统 大量 数据 报时 数据处理 方法 | ||
1、一种移动通信系统中大量数据上报时的数据处理方法,其特征在于,设置两级缓存,包括以下步骤:
当有消息需要入缓存时,将收到的消息追加到第一级缓存队列的尾部;
当第一级缓存队列有数据时,提取第一级缓存队列头部的消息,根据预先设置的分流策略选定处理所述消息的消费者线程所对应的第二级缓存,将所述消息追加到选定的第二级缓存队列尾部;
消费者线程从第二级缓存中获取数据并处理。
2、如权利要求1所述的方法,其特征在于,当有消息需要入缓存时,先判断第一级缓存的数据量是否超过预设的阈值,如果是,则将第一级缓存中的数据全部删除后,再将所述消息追加到第一级缓存队列的尾部,否则直接将收到的消息追加到第一级缓存队列的尾部。
3、如权利要求2所述的方法,其特征在于,删除第一级缓存中数据时,暂停消息的加入,将此时收到的消息直接丢弃。
4、如权利要求1所述的方法,其特征在于,所述分流策略是指将消息分类的策略。
5、如权利要求4所述的方法,其特征在于,根据以下参数任意之一对消息进行分类:消息来源、消息类型、消息大小。
6、如权利要求1所述的方法,其特征在于,在选定第二级缓存后,判断所述第二级缓存中的数据量是否超过预设的阈值,如果是,则不处理,否则,将所述消息追加到选定的第二级缓存队列尾部。
7、如权利要求6所述的方法,其特征在于,所述不处理是指将从第一级缓存队列提取的消息直接丢弃。
8、如权利要求1所述的方法,其特征在于,消费者线程从第二级缓存队列头获取数据,同时将所述数据从第二级缓存队列中删除。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于中兴通讯股份有限公司,未经中兴通讯股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/200710138755.8/1.html,转载请声明来源钻瓜专利网。
- 上一篇:多种燃气的炊具中设置的旋转阀
- 下一篇:修饰的Fc分子